Diverse Materials Used in Molding
In our high-end engineering, we use a wide array of materials for our plastic injection molds. Some of these materials include ABS, PBT, LCP, PEEK, styrene, polyetherimide, polypropylene, nylons, and polycarbonate. Similarly, we combine materials with fillers, like Teflon, mineral, glass, and carbon fibers.
